  • Publication number: 20110104332
    Abstract: A method of producing curd or cheese from a milk composition comprising the following steps: (1) heat-treating the milk composition; (2) treating the milk composition or a fraction thereof with a phospholipase; (3) adding protein hydrolysate, preferably yeast extract, to the heat-treated milk composition before or after the heat treatment; (4) coagulating the heat treated milk to form a gel; (5) processing the formed gel into a curd and separating the whey from the curd; and (6) optionally making cheese from the curd.

  • Publication number: 20100074991
    Abstract: The invention relates to newly identified polynucleotide sequences comprising a gene that encodes a novel oxidoreductase isolated from Aspergillus niger. The invention features the full length nucleotide sequence of the novel gene, the cDNA sequence comprising the full length coding sequence of the novel oxidoreductase as well as the amino acid sequence of the full-length functional protein and functional equivalents thereof. The invention also relates to methods of using these enzymes in baking and in dairy applications. Also included in the invention are cells transformed with a polynucleotide according to the invention and cells wherein a oxidoreductase according to the invention is genetically modified to enhance or reduce its activity and/or level of expression.
